About 72 million euros to over 82,000 beneficiaries will be paid in the framework of the payments that will be made by e-EFKA and OAED during the week of January 17-21, 2022.
Particularly:
1. From e-EFKA in the period 17-21 January the following payments will be made, within the framework of the regular payments of the Agency:
– 19.7 million euros will be paid to 580 beneficiaries following the issuance of one-off decisions
– 13.4 million euros will be paid to 22,976 beneficiaries for cash benefits
– 32,000 euros will be paid to 40 beneficiaries for inheritance benefits of supplementary pension
2. The following payments will be made by OAED:
– EUR 20 million to 52,000 beneficiaries for the payment of unemployment benefits and other benefits
– EUR 18 million to 5,500 beneficiaries under subsidized employment schemes
– 600,000 euros to 700 mothers for a subsidized maternity leave
